We found 5 dictionaries that define the word kite falcon:
General (5 matching dictionaries)
General (5 matching dictionaries)
- kite falcon: Merriam-Webster
- kite-falcon, kite falcon: Wordnik
- Kite falcon: Dictionary.com
- kite falcon: FreeDictionary.org
- Kite falcon: TheFreeDictionary.com